Abstract

An organic-inorganic composite molded product formed by molding a composite material of an organic resin and inorganic fine particles is provided, and in this molded product, the average primary particle diameter of the inorganic fine particles is 1 to 30 nm, the concentration of the inorganic fine particles is 25 to 50 percent by volume, and the porosity is 20 to 55 percent by volume. Accordingly, an organic-inorganic composite molded product having a small content of the inorganic fine particles and a significantly low average coefficient of linear expansion of 20*10 −6 to −110*10 −6 /degree Celsius can be manufactured.

1 . An organic-inorganic composite molded product comprising:
 inorganic fine particles having an average primary particle diameter of 1 to 30 nm; and   an organic resin,   wherein the concentration of the inorganic fine particles is 25 to 50 percent by volume, and   the porosity of the organic-inorganic composite molded product is 20 to 55 percent by volume.   
     
     
         2 . The organic-inorganic composite molded product according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the average coefficient of linear expansion of the organic-inorganic composite molded product is 20*10 −6  to −110*10 −6 /degree Celsius.   
     
     
         3 . The organic-inorganic composite molded product according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the inorganic fine particles include SiO 2  or ZrO 2 .   
     
     
         4 . The organic-inorganic composite molded product according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the organic resin is a thermoplastic resin selected from a poly(methyl methacrylate) resin, a polycarbonate resin, a polystyrene resin, and a cyclic olefin resin.   
     
     
         5 . An optical element comprising:
 the organic-inorganic composite molded product according to  claim 1 .   
     
     
         6 . The optical element according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the optical element comprises a lens which transmits light.   
     
     
         7 . The optical element according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the optical element comprises a reflective mirror which reflects light.
